ngx-textarea-autosize
Version:
Angular 2+ directive to automatically control height textarea to fit content

import * as tslib_1 from "tslib";
import { Directive, ElementRef, HostListener, Input, HostBinding, Renderer2 } from '@angular/core';
var AutosizeDirective = /** @class */ (function () {
function AutosizeDirective(elem, renderer) {
this.elem = elem;
this.renderer = renderer;
this.overflow = 'hidden';
this.rows = 1;
}
AutosizeDirective.prototype.ngAfterViewInit = function () {
this.resize();
};
AutosizeDirective.prototype.ngDoCheck = function () {
this.resize();
};
AutosizeDirective.prototype.resize = function () {
var textarea = this.elem.nativeElement;
// Calculate border height which is not included in scrollHeight
var borderHeight = textarea.offsetHeight - textarea.clientHeight;
// Reset textarea height to auto that correctly calculate the new height
this.setHeight('auto');
// Set new height
this.setHeight(textarea.scrollHeight + borderHeight + "px");
};
AutosizeDirective.prototype.setHeight = function (value) {
this.renderer.setStyle(this.elem.nativeElement, 'height', value);
};
tslib_1.__decorate([
HostBinding('style.overflow'),
tslib_1.__metadata("design:type", Object)
], AutosizeDirective.prototype, "overflow", void 0);
tslib_1.__decorate([
Input(),
HostBinding('rows'),
tslib_1.__metadata("design:type", Object)
], AutosizeDirective.prototype, "rows", void 0);
tslib_1.__decorate([
HostListener('input'),
tslib_1.__metadata("design:type", Function),
tslib_1.__metadata("design:paramtypes", []),
tslib_1.__metadata("design:returntype", void 0)
], AutosizeDirective.prototype, "resize", null);
AutosizeDirective = tslib_1.__decorate([
Directive({
selector: 'textarea[autosize]'
}),
tslib_1.__metadata("design:paramtypes", [ElementRef, Renderer2])
], AutosizeDirective);
return AutosizeDirective;
}());
export { AutosizeDirective };
